Vince Young never felt trusted by Titans coach Fisher

Tennessee Titans owner Bud Adams announced Wednesday that his team would come back next year without quarterback Vince Young(notes) on the roster.

While Young thanked Adams and head coach Jeff Fisher for five years of work and a chance to win the Super Bowl, he also told the Tennessean that he never felt fully trusted by Fisher.

"I have nothing against Jeff Fisher. I just wish he would have trusted me a little more. That was the only issue," Young told the Tennessean. "I didn't feel like [Jeff] trusted me. In the five years I was there, I was always looking over my shoulder."

Young went on to say that he had done a lot of work but that "I didn't feel like I was [Fisher's] guy all the way."

Now he'll try to find that trust elsewhere.
